Eligibility
- Films made between January 1, 2024, and October 31, 2026, are eligible.
- The film can be entered by any organization, agency, individual film producer/director, or college student who holds the copyright.
- There is no restriction on the number of entries.
Procedure
-
Applicants must complete all required fields and provide accurate information. Applicants must upload the film synopsis, screening link, subtitles (where applicable), poster, photographs/stills, filmmaker bio-data and required supporting documents. Campus Film applicants must submit a valid Student ID Card; institutions/colleges must provide the required institutional details.
The duly signed Filmmaker Consent & OTT Declaration must be submitted along with the entry.
All materials must be submitted in the prescribed format within the specified deadline. Incomplete submissions may not be considered.
Entry Fee
- To be paid through online payment gateway (Entry fee is non-refundable)
- Feature Film : Rs. 2500/-
- Short Film : Rs. 1500/-
- Documentary Film : Rs. 1500/-
- Music Video : Rs. 1500/-
- AI Short Film : Rs. 1000/-
- Campus Film : Rs. 500/-
- Entrant is required to submit film in H.264/MP4 (under 5 GB with 1920x1080 resolution) through Vimeo Link/ Google Drive.

Selection Process
- Entries will be previewed by a duly constituted Selection Committee, which will select/ recommend best films for the competition sections.
- Festival Selection Committee will have the right to make copies for pre-selection / selection purpose.
- The decision of the Selection Committees shall be final & binding on all.
- Film once selected and submitted for the final screening, will not be allowed to be withdrawn under any circumstances.
- Participation in the festival implies acceptance of Festival Regulations.
Jury
- A duly constituted Jury shall determine the winning films in respective categories. The decision of the Jury will be final and binding on all.
- The Jury reserves the right to withhold an award in any category where no entry, in the Jury's view, meet the standards for award / recognition.
- It also reserves the right to recommend sharing of award(s) in any category and to recommend special Jury award/Certificate of Merit.
